BitKeep is a decentralized digital asset wallet designed to provide users with a professional one-stop service, support multi-wallet management, exchange asset docking, and cover financial lending, cloud - mining, Dapp, games, blockchain payment, and other functions. The wallet supports now over 1000 cryptocurrencies, including BTC, ETH, EOS, LTC and more. BitKeep has recently launched version 3.0, which supports aggregate trading.
Block.io is meant to be easy to use, fast, and secure.
